Ramadan is the ninth month of the islamic calendar, but the date changes each year. The date for the start of ramadan is slightly different each year, depending on the position of the moon. Ramadan, one of the months in the islamic calendar, was also part of ancient arabs’ calendars.
Ramadan, The Ninth Month Of The Islamic Calendar, Is Observed By Muslims Worldwide As A Month Of Fasting, Prayer, Reflection And Community.
The word ramadan means scorching in arabic. Ramadan (sometimes spelled ramadhan) is the ninth month of the islamic calendar, during which muslims fast or do not eat or drink during the daytime. Islamic calendar’s 9 th month is known as ramadan.

It shifts 11 days earlier each year. The 27th night of ramadan is celebrated as the night of power, or lailat al kadr. Ramadan is the ninth month of the islamic lunar calendar, which begins with the sighting of the new moon.
